Lucius Carter, 86, N. Augusta, S.C., formerly of Fayette County, died Feb. 4, 2009. He was born Oct. 11, 1926 in Haralson, son of Wylie C. and Roxanna Milner Carter. He was preceded in death by his parents, five brothers, and five sisters. He was a POW in World War II, and was a past Master of Masonic Lodge F&AM 590, Hapeville. Services were at the Carl J. Mowell chapel with the Rev. Jim Willis and the Rev. Dan Houston officiating. Interment was at Camp Memorial Park, Fayetteville.

Survivors include his wife of 64 years, Margaret "Elizabeth" Carter, North Augusta, S.C.; a son, Michael Carter, N. Augusta; a daughter, Maria and Charles Lambert, N. Augusta; grandchildren, Michael and Vickie Lambert, N. Augusta, and Daniel and Ashley Lambert, Cumming; and five great-grandchildren. Carl J. Mowell & Son Funeral Home, Fayetteville, was in charge.
